Hi, thats was so dumb of me. I just didn't load the optimal defaults before backing it up and modifying, so probably all those settings got carried forward to the new rom. I tried again with unlocking just one setting "Enhanced turbo" and it worked. Now, I am running my processor's all cores at 4.4 GHz. So, now I will unlock the voltage setting and that will be all.

But I have got just one confusion. Some settings are appearing twice or even four times in that bios editor. See this screenshot below. Is it normal ? Am I supposed to set all of them to "User" ? Or just one out of the 2 or 4 ?
